Most VHM 314 variants operate between 4.5V and 24V DC. The datasheet will specify if it is a 5V-only device or if it supports 12V industrial rails. Look for the "Supply Voltage Rejection Ratio" – how well the device ignores noise on the power line.

This is the "gain" of the sensor. For example, a sensitivity of 2.5 mV/G means a 100 Gauss field will change the output by 250mV. Do not guess this value; consult the free datasheet.
